ADO 基本概念
ADO 可為開發人員提供功能強大的邏輯物件模型,並透過 OLE DB 系統介面以程式設計方式存取、編輯及更新各種資料來源的資料。 ADO 最常見的用法是查詢關聯式資料庫中的資料表、擷取並顯示應用程式中的結果,以及讓使用者對資料進行變更並儲存。 其他工作包括下列各項:
使用 SQL 查詢資料庫並顯示結果。
透過網際網路存取檔案存放區中的資訊。
操作電子郵件系統中的郵件與資料夾。
將資料從資料庫儲存到 XML 檔案中。
執行以 XML 描述的命令並擷取 XML 資料流。
將資料儲存到二進位或 XML 資料流。
允許使用者檢閱及變更資料庫資料表中的資料。
建立並重複使用參數化資料庫命令。
執行預存程序。
動態建立名為資料錄集的彈性結構,以保存、瀏覽及操作資料。
執行交易資料庫作業。
根據執行階段準則篩選及排序資料庫資訊的本機複本。
從資料庫建立及操作階層式結果。
將資料庫欄位繫結至資料感知元件。
建立遠端且中斷連線的資料錄集。
ADO 會公開各種不同的選項與設定,以提供這類彈性。 因此,請務必採用有條理的方法,以了解如何在應用程式中使用 ADO,將您的每個目標細分成可管理的部分。
使用 ADO 的大部分應用程式都涉及四個主要作業:取得資料、檢查資料、編輯資料,以及更新資料。 此節稍後會更詳細地說明這些作業。
不過,在討論這些詳細資料之前,我們將提供 ADO 物件模型的概觀和簡單的 ADO 應用程式,其是以 Visual Basic 撰寫,並能執行全部四個主要 ADO 作業:
OLE DB 提供者 (部分機器翻譯)